Moving the new #endif /* USELESS_XT_MACROS */ a few lines up makes some (all?) files from lib build again. Hmm, seems I haven't got it right anyway since it just stopped in lib/Xm/DragIcon.c: In function `_XmDestroyDefaultDragIcon': lib/Xm/DragIcon.c:850: structure has no member named `core' What are the side-effects of dropping those macros?? (may be good ones, just asking) -- Alexander Mai [EMAIL PROTECTED]
